What is the difference between SATA and NVMe SSDs?

The primary difference between Serial Advanced Technology Attachment (SATA) and Non-Volatile Memory Express (NVMe) solid-state drives (SSDs) lies in their functions and efficiencies. SATA, an older type of interface, connects the motherboard to the storage devices, while NVMe, a newer technology, enables storage devices to take advantage of high-speed PCIe bus connections. Putting it differently, these two SSD types differ in their data transfer speeds, protocols, and configurations.

Both SATA and NVMe SSDs serve as dynamic data storage systems in modern computers, yet NVMe usually outperforms SATA in terms of speed and efficiency. Companies specializing in consumer electronics, like ExtremeSpec, typically offer a variety of SSDs, including both SATA and NVMe models. For consumers, the choice between SATA and NVMe often boils down to specific needs, budget constraints, and desired system performance.

What is SATA and how does it work in SSDs?

What is SATA and

SATA is a computer bus interface that links the motherboard to storage devices like hard disk drives (HDDs) or solid-state drives (SSDs). Responsibly handling data transfer, SATA SSDs operate via the AHCI protocol, which doesn’t require a physical connection between the storage device and the motherboard. However, this protocol limits the speed at which data can move, restricting the overall efficiency of SATA SSDs.

The operation of SATA in SSDs is still sufficient for most common tasks, making it a popular choice for average users. Yet, as technology continues to evolve, faster and more efficient SSD solutions, like NVMe, provide significant advantages, particularly for users who require high-speed data transfers for tasks such as video editing, large file transfers, or gaming.

How does NVMe technology function in SSDs?

What is SATA and

NVMe technology, on the other hand, is designed to harness the performance potential of SSDs. Unlike SATA, NVMe operates over the PCIe bus, which has a more direct connection to the computer’s CPU. This type of interface allows NVMe SSDs to process large amounts of data simultaneously, significantly improving read-write speeds and overall system performance.

More specifically, NVMe SSDs don’t face the queue depth limitations assailant to SATA SSDs. This techno-functional difference means that NVMe drives can handle multiple data requests more efficiently, utilizing the full capabilities of the SSD. With this enhancement in SSD functionality, NVMe is drastically changing the technology landscape, propelling us into a new era of high-performance data processing.

Is NVMe faster than SATA for SSDs?

What is SATA and

Indeed, NVMe generally offers faster speeds than SATA for SSDs. NVMe’s direct connection to the CPU via PCIe and the use of high parallelism in its command set allow for speedier data transfer. In fact, NVMe drives often achieve read-write speeds four to six times faster than their SATA counterparts, making NVMe SSDs the preferred choice for high-demand computational tasks.

However, while NVMe does offer higher speed benchmarks than SATA, it’s important to note that for most everyday computer tasks, the difference in speed might not be distinctly apparent to the average user. Nonetheless, for tasks requiring high-volume data processing or demanding read-write operation, NVMe SSDs will unequivocally provide a speed advantage over SATA SSDs.

Advantages of SATA SSDs:

  • SATA SSDs are more affordable than NVMe SSDs.
  • They provide faster data transfer speeds compared to traditional hard drives.
  • SATA SSDs can be easily installed in most laptops and desktop computers.
  • These SSDs offer reliable storage options for everyday tasks.
  • SATA SSDs consume less power, resulting in increased battery life for laptops.
  • They are compatible with a wide range of devices and operating systems.
  • SATA SSDs are available in various storage capacities, catering to different user needs.

Can you use both SATA and NVMe SSDs in the same system?

Yes, you can integrate both SATA and NVMe SSDs into the same computer system. This setup allows you to leverage the distinct advantages offered by SATA and NVMe SSD technologies, maximizing your system’s performance and storage capabilities. Just ensure your motherboard has SATA ports for the SATA drives and M.2 slots for the NVMe drives.

Brands like Samsung and Western Digital offer both SATA and NVMe drives, providing a variety of options for those building or upgrading their systems. Keep in mind, using SATA and NVMe SSDs in the same system does not cause any compatibility issues or conflicts; the key lies in having the appropriate hardware infrastructure to support them.

What are the price differences between SATA and NVMe SSDs?

The price of SSDs, whether SATA or NVMe, varies based on several factors including storage capacity, speed, longevity, and brand. Typically, SATA SSDs present a more budget-friendly option, whereas NVMe SSDs are more premium-priced due to their superior performance.

For instance, a SATA SSD from an established provider such as Crucial might be significantly more affordable compared to a high-performance NVMe SSD from a brand like Seagate. In essence, selecting between SATA and NVMe should revolve around your specific needs, factoring in cost, performance, and storage requirements.

Does the choice between SATA and NVMe affect battery life in laptops?

Yes, the choice between SATA and NVMe SSDs can have an impact on your laptop’s battery life. The higher the performance of the SSD, the more power it typically consumes. Since NVMe SSDs deliver quicker speeds than their SATA counterparts, they usually draw more power, potentially reducing battery endurance.

For example, brands like Intel or Kingston that offer NVMe drives usually feature power management schemes to balance performance and power consumption. In practical terms, though, the impact on your laptop’s battery life due to the choice of SSD might not be significantly perceivable, as it just forms a part of the total power consumption picture.

Advantages of NVMe SSDs:

  • NVMe SSDs deliver significantly faster read and write speeds than SATA SSDs.
  • They offer improved performance for demanding applications, such as video editing and gaming.
  • NVMe SSDs utilize the PCIe interface, allowing for higher bandwidth and reduced latency.
  • These SSDs can handle heavy workloads, making them suitable for professional use.
  • NVMe SSDs support increased parallelism, enabling multiple simultaneous operations.
  • They provide faster boot times and application loading, enhancing overall system responsiveness.
  • NVMe SSDs come in compact sizes, enabling them to be used in slim laptops and compact desktops.

How do SATA and NVMe SSDs compare in terms of durability?

When comparing the durability of SATA and NVMe SSDs, it’s important to first understand the fundamental distinction between the two types. The SATA interface, used in traditional hard drives, has a lower overall speed, which can limit the lifespan of the SSD. On the other hand, NVMe SSDs offer greater performance, and as a result, may present a longer-lasting option.

However, NVMe SSDs, despite their superior performance, are not inherently more resilient. The key factor dictating an SSD’s endurance, whether it’s a SATA or NVMe, is the nature of the NAND flash memory chips used within. These chips have a finite number of write cycles, after which they start losing their efficiency. Consequently, the durability comparison between SATA and NVMe SSDs may be more a function of the respective SSD’s design and manufacturing quality, rather than the interface technology itself.

Can you convert a SATA SSD to NVMe or vice versa?

Conversion between SATA SSD and NVMe is not feasible due to intrinsic technological differences. A SATA SSD operates via the AHCI (Advanced Host Controller Interface) protocol, designed for hard drives, whereas an NVMe SSD uses the NVMe (Non-Volatile Memory express) protocol, specifically created for flash memory like SSDs.

While various adapters or enclosures might allow a physical SATA SSD to connect to an NVMe slot, or an NVMe SSD to connect to a SATA slot, these converters can’t change a drive’s inherent protocol. So, despite the physical connection, a SATA SSD will never become an NVMe SSD and vice versa, just by using adapters or enclosures.

Are there specific use-cases where SATA is preferable to NVMe?

Even though NVMe SSDs offer better performance with faster read/write speeds, SATA SSDs are still popular in certain circumstances. An evident scenario for preferring SATA over NVMe is cost-efficiency. In cases where an application doesn’t demand high speeds or greater throughputs, SATA SSDs deliver satisfactory performance at a much lower cost than NVMe SSDs.

Besides, due to the broader adoption and longer presence in the market, SATA SSDs are often chosen for their compatibility with older systems. Many older systems don’t support NVMe natively, making SATA SSDs the better choice in those scenarios. Moreover, some use-cases may not benefit tremendously from the high speed of NVMe SSDs, making the cost-effective SATA SSDs a reasonable choice.

How do the warranties compare for SATA and NVMe SSDs?

Warranty periods for both SATA and NVMe SSDs typically depend on the manufacturer, not the technology type. Standard warranty periods range from 3 to 5 years for both types. However, the warranty may also be contingent on other factors, such as the total bytes written (TBW), a measure of the total amount of data that can be written to an SSD over its lifetime.

Higher-end NVMe SSDs, due to their superior performance capacity, generally come with greater TBW ratings indicating more data can be written to them over their lifespans compared to SATA SSDs. Nevertheless, a higher TBW doesn’t equate to a longer warranty. Ultimately, whether it’s a SATA SSD or an NVMe SSD, the warranty details are best verified with the specific manufacturer and the particular SSD model.

Other Related Questions

  1. How can I identify if my motherboard supports PCIe 4.0?
  2. How does the motherboard BIOS work, and how do I update it?
  3. How do I know if a motherboard supports dual-channel memory?
  4. What is the difference between ATX and microATX motherboards?
  5. What is the role of the chipset on a motherboard?

Scroll to Top